Backup-WebConfiguration
Backup-WebConfiguration
Creates a backup of an IIS configuration.
Syntax
Parameter Set: Default
Backup-WebConfiguration [-Name] <String> [ <CommonParameters>]
Detailed Description
Creates a backup of an IIS configuration. A folder named with the value of theNameparameter is created for the backup in the $env:Windir\System32\inetsrv\backup folder.
Parameters
-Name<String>
The name of the folder created to store the backup files. If a backup with the name specified already exists, an error is returned.

Examples
-------------- EXAMPLE 1: Backing up an IIS configuration --------------
Demonstrates how to create a backup of your IIS configuration in a folder named "MyIISBackup".
Name Creation Date
---- -------------
MyIISBackup 2/20/2009 12:00:00 AM
IIS:\>Backup-WebConfiguration -Name MyIISBackup
